The ICMR-NIIRNCD (National Institute for Implementation Research on Non-communicable Diseases, Jodhpur) has announced recruitment for 13 vacancies under the Indian Council of Medical Research (ICMR). The positions include Project Scientist-B, Field Supervisor, and Multi-Tasking Staff on a project basis. 🔹Total Vacancies: 13
🔹Organization: ICMR-NIIRNCD, Jodhpur
🔹Type of Job: Walk-in Interview (Project-Based)
🔹Work Location: Rajasthan
🔹Salary Range: ₹15,800 – ₹67,000 per month
🟦Post-wise Vacancy & Qualification:
1. Project Scientist-B – 01 Post
Qualification: MBBS / BDS / BHMS / BAMS
2. Field Supervisor – 10 Posts
Qualification: B.Sc Nursing
3. Multi-Tasking Staff – 02 Posts
Qualification: 12th Pass
🟩Age Criteria:
Minimum Age: 21 years
Maximum Age: 40 years
(Relaxation as per ICMR rules.)
🟨Selection Process:
Walk-in Interview only.
🟩Application Fee:
No Application Fee – participation is completely free.
🟦How to Apply:
1. Visit the official NIIRNCD website and download the notification.
2. Read all eligibility instructions carefully.
3. Download and fill the application form correctly.
4. Attach self-attested copies of necessary documents.
5. Carry the filled form and documents directly to the interview venue mentioned in the official notification.
📅 Important Dates:
Starting Date: 31-Oct-2025
Walk-in / Last Date: 10-Nov-2025
